如何通过网络性能监控诊断提高网络运维效率?
在当今信息化时代,网络已成为企业运营的重要基础设施。然而,随着网络规模的不断扩大和复杂性的增加,网络故障和性能问题也日益突出。如何通过网络性能监控诊断提高网络运维效率,成为许多企业关注的焦点。本文将从以下几个方面展开探讨。
一、网络性能监控的重要性
网络性能监控是指对网络设备、链路、应用等各个层面的性能指标进行实时监测和分析。通过网络性能监控,可以及时发现网络故障、性能瓶颈等问题,从而提高网络运维效率。
1. 预防性维护
通过实时监控网络性能,可以提前发现潜在问题,避免故障发生。例如,当网络流量超过预设阈值时,系统会自动发出警报,运维人员可以提前采取措施,避免网络拥堵。
2. 故障定位
当网络出现故障时,通过性能监控可以快速定位故障原因,提高故障排除效率。例如,当某条链路出现故障时,监控系统能够迅速识别出故障链路,从而缩短故障修复时间。
3. 性能优化
网络性能监控可以帮助运维人员了解网络运行状况,分析性能瓶颈,从而对网络进行优化。例如,通过监控发现某台服务器负载过高,可以调整服务器配置或增加服务器资源。
二、网络性能监控诊断方法
1. 实时监控
实时监控是网络性能监控的基础。通过实时采集网络设备、链路、应用等各个层面的性能数据,可以全面了解网络运行状况。常用的实时监控方法包括:
- SNMP(简单网络管理协议):通过SNMP协议,可以实时获取网络设备的性能数据,如CPU利用率、内存使用率、带宽使用率等。
- NetFlow/IPFIX:NetFlow/IPFIX是一种数据采集技术,可以实时记录网络流量信息,用于分析网络流量模式、识别异常流量等。
- Wireshark:Wireshark是一款网络抓包工具,可以实时捕获网络数据包,用于分析网络故障和性能问题。
2. 历史数据分析
历史数据分析是对网络性能数据进行长期积累和分析,从而发现网络运行规律和潜在问题。常用的历史数据分析方法包括:
- 性能趋势分析:通过分析网络性能数据的变化趋势,可以发现网络性能瓶颈和潜在问题。
- 故障分析:通过对历史故障数据的分析,可以总结故障原因,为故障预防提供依据。
3. 主动探测
主动探测是指通过模拟网络流量,主动检测网络设备、链路、应用等各个层面的性能。常用的主动探测方法包括:
- ping测试:通过ping测试可以检测网络设备的可达性和响应时间。
- traceroute:traceroute可以检测数据包在网络中的传输路径,从而定位网络故障。
- 压力测试:通过压力测试可以模拟高负载情况,检测网络设备的性能。
三、案例分析
案例一:某企业网络拥堵问题
某企业网络出现拥堵问题,导致网络速度变慢,影响业务运营。通过网络性能监控,发现网络流量超过预设阈值,且存在大量异常流量。经分析,发现异常流量来自某台服务器,该服务器正在运行大量非法软件。通过隔离该服务器,网络拥堵问题得到解决。
案例二:某企业数据中心故障
某企业数据中心出现故障,导致业务中断。通过网络性能监控,发现故障原因可能是某条链路故障。通过traceroute定位故障链路,发现该链路已断开。及时更换故障链路,业务恢复正常。
四、总结
网络性能监控诊断是提高网络运维效率的重要手段。通过实时监控、历史数据分析、主动探测等方法,可以及时发现网络故障、性能瓶颈等问题,从而提高网络运维效率。企业应重视网络性能监控,建立完善的监控体系,确保网络稳定运行。
猜你喜欢:全栈可观测